The white grape variety comes from Moldova. There are more than 60 synonyms which indicate the high age of the vine. Some of them are Pineapple, Courbeau Blanc, Fehér Jardovany, Giordan, Gordan, Iordana, Iordan Pineapple, Iordan Galben, Iordana, Iordovan, Iordovana, Iordovany, Jordan, Jordana, Jordan Galben, Jordovan, Klein Silberweiß, Timpurie, Pataki, Vilagos, Zemoasa and Zemoasse. According to DNA analyses carried out in 2013, this is one of the many direct descendants of Gouais Blanc (Heunisch), the second parent is unknown. However, this is based on only 20 DNA markers (see molecular genetics). It is a parent of the Plavay variety. The vine produces acid accentuated white wines. It is cultivated in Romania and used mainly for sparkling wines. In 2016, 311 hectares of vineyards were designated (Kym Anderson).
